[bs_lead]Oral Health Watch is a broad-based coalition that works to raise the visibility of the importance of oral health and to advocate for increased access to care.[/bs_lead]
Members consist of dental, medical, labor and business organizations, as well as children’s and seniors’ advocacy groups. Through policy advocacy, grassroots organizing, earned media, and paid media, Oral Health Watch is drawing attention to the prevalence of oral disease, its consequences, and the need for solutions.

Tooth decay is the most common chronic childhood disease even though cavities are largely preventable. But it doesn't have to be that way. Access to regular dental visits, community water fluoridation, and a consistent home oral health care routine can make it possible for kids to grow up ...cavity-free. #teethmatter
